Class InvokeMemberOption
Inheritance
InvokeMemberOption
Syntax
public class InvokeMemberOption : MemberUnitOption<InvokeMember>, IMemberUnitOption, IGenericSubstitutableUnitOption, IShellSubstitutableUnitOption, IUnitOption, IFuzzyOption
Constructors
InvokeMemberOption()
Declaration
public InvokeMemberOption()
InvokeMemberOption(InvokeMember)
Declaration
public InvokeMemberOption(InvokeMember unit)
Parameters
Properties
action
Declaration
protected override MemberAction action { get; }
Property Value
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.action
Methods
Haystack(Boolean)
Declaration
protected override string Haystack(bool human)
Parameters
Type |
Name |
Description |
Boolean |
human |
|
Returns
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.Haystack(System.Boolean)
Icons()
Declaration
public override IEnumerable<EditorTexture> Icons()
Returns
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.Icons()
Label(Boolean)
Declaration
protected override string Label(bool human)
Parameters
Type |
Name |
Description |
Boolean |
human |
|
Returns
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.Label(System.Boolean)
Order()
Declaration
protected override int Order()
Returns
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.Order()
SearchResultLabel(String)
Declaration
public override string SearchResultLabel(string query)
Parameters
Type |
Name |
Description |
String |
query |
|
Returns
Overrides
Ludiq.Bolt.UnitOption<Ludiq.Bolt.InvokeMember>.SearchResultLabel(System.String)
SubstituteBoltType(BoltType)
Declaration
public override IUnitOption SubstituteBoltType(BoltType type)
Parameters
Returns
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.SubstituteBoltType(Ludiq.Bolt.BoltType)
SubstituteGeneric(Type, Type)
Declaration
public override IUnitOption SubstituteGeneric(Type genericDefinition, Type substitutedType)
Parameters
Type |
Name |
Description |
Type |
genericDefinition |
|
Type |
substitutedType |
|
Returns
Overrides
Ludiq.Bolt.MemberUnitOption<Ludiq.Bolt.InvokeMember>.SubstituteGeneric(System.Type, System.Type)
Extension Methods